高效、弹性、安全——云服务器软件架构首选
云服务器软件架构

首页 2024-06-30 22:24:16



云服务器软件架构的深度解析 随着信息技术的飞速发展,云计算已成为企业和组织实现数字化转型、提高运营效率、增强业务灵活性和创新能力的关键技术

    云服务器作为云计算的核心组成部分,其软件架构的设计和实现对于整个云计算系统的性能和稳定性至关重要

    本文将对云服务器软件架构进行深度解析,探讨其关键组成部分、设计原则以及未来发展趋势

     一、云服务器软件架构概述 云服务器软件架构是一个复杂的系统,它基于虚拟化技术,将物理资源(如CPU、内存、存储和网络等)抽象成逻辑资源,通过软件定义的方式实现资源的动态分配和管理

    云服务器软件架构主要包括以下几个关键组成部分: 1. 虚拟化层:虚拟化层是云服务器软件架构的基础,它通过将物理资源抽象成虚拟资源,实现资源的池化和动态调度

    虚拟化层通常包括计算虚拟化、存储虚拟化、网络虚拟化等模块,它们共同协作,为用户提供灵活、可扩展的虚拟资源

     2. 资源管理层:资源管理层负责管理和调度虚拟资源,确保资源的有效利用和高效运行

    它通常包括资源调度器、负载均衡器、自动扩展模块等,能够根据用户需求和应用场景,自动调整资源分配和配置,提高系统的整体性能和可靠性

     3. 服务层:服务层是云服务器软件架构的核心,它提供了一系列云服务接口和API,供用户和开发者使用

    服务层通常包括计算服务、存储服务、网络服务、安全服务等模块,它们能够满足用户多样化的需求,提供丰富的云计算服务

     4. 管理层:管理层负责对整个云服务器软件架构进行监控、管理和维护

    它通常包括监控模块、告警模块、日志管理模块等,能够实时收集和分析系统数据,提供故障预警和诊断功能,确保系统的稳定运行和安全性

     二、云服务器软件架构设计原则 在设计和实现云服务器软件架构时,需要遵循以下几个原则: 1. 模块化设计:将软件架构划分为多个独立的模块,每个模块负责特定的功能

    这样可以提高软件的可维护性和可扩展性,方便后续的升级和扩展

     2. 高可用性设计:通过冗余设计、负载均衡、容错处理等技术手段,确保系统的高可用性

    即使某个模块出现故障,也能通过其他模块继续提供服务,保证系统的稳定运行

     3. 可伸缩性设计:根据用户需求和应用场景的变化,动态调整资源分配和配置

    通过自动扩展和缩减资源,实现系统的灵活性和可扩展性

     4. 安全性设计:采用多层次的安全防护措施,包括数据加密、身份认证、访问控制等,确保用户数据的安全性和隐私性

     三、云服务器软件架构未来发展趋势 随着云计算技术的不断发展和应用需求的不断增长,云服务器软件架构将呈现以下发展趋势: 1. 智能化发展:通过引入人工智能、大数据等技术手段,实现系统的智能化管理和优化

    通过智能调度、智能监控等功能,提高系统的自动化水平和运行效率

     2. 边缘计算兴起:随着物联网、智能家居等应用场景的普及,边缘计算将成为云计算的重要组成部分

    通过将计算和存储资源放置在离用户更近的边缘设备上,提高数据传输效率和响应速度

     3. 安全性和隐私保护:随着云计算规模的不断扩大,安全性和隐私保护问题将越来越受到关注

    云服务器软件架构将进一步加强安全技术的研发和应用,提供更加安全可靠的服务和保障用户数据的隐私性

    

最新文章

  • 绿色护眼壁纸,清晰视界,呵护双眼健康

  • 高效、弹性、安全——云服务器软件架构首选

  • 向日葵远程控制32位:高效、稳定,掌控无界!

  • Win10复制粘贴失效,急需解决方案!

  • 网页考试防作弊,如何应对无法复制粘贴?

  • 顶级免费远程控制软件,十款精选任你挑!

  • | 标题样式 | 创意标题(20字以内) |- | --- | --- || 正式风格 | 数据精准,一键复制粘贴无忧 || 简洁明了 | 快速复制,高效粘贴,省时省力 || 创意新颖 | 复制粘贴,形状各异,轻松变换 || 权威专业 | 精确复制,无误粘贴,专业之选 || 亲和友好 | 轻松一点,复制粘贴随心所欲 |

  • 相关文章

  • 向日葵远程控制32位:高效、稳定,掌控无界!

  • | 标题样式 | 创意标题(20字以内) |- | --- | --- || 正式风格 | 数据精准,一键复制粘贴无忧 || 简洁明了 | 快速复制,高效粘贴,省时省力 || 创意新颖 | 复制粘贴,形状各异,轻松变换 || 权威专业 | 精确复制,无误粘贴,专业之选 || 亲和友好 | 轻松一点,复制粘贴随心所欲 |

  • 一键粘贴为数值,高效处理数据不费力!

  • 远程桌面链接操作:轻松连接,高效工作!

  • 视频秒转文字,智能提取,一键高效!

  • 高效清理:备份文件删除攻略与技巧

  • 搭建FTP网站,轻松实现文件高效传输!

  • Windows 3389远程桌面:高效、稳定、远程协作首选

  • 电话号码备份,首选XX备份软件,安全可靠!

  • 掌握远程桌面连接,高效指令教学(以下是对标题的解释和具体内容的展开)标题“掌握远程桌面连接,高效指令教学”旨在以简洁而有力的方式传达远程桌面连接命令的重要性和实用性。下面将详细解释这一命令的使用方法和步骤。远程桌面连接(Remote Desktop Connection)是一种允许用户从一台计算机(称为“客户端”)远程访问和控制另一台计算机(称为“远程计算机”或“主机”)的技术。在企业管理、技术支持和远程工作等领域中,远

  • 批处理修改远程端口,高效安全!

  • 远程桌面设置详解:高效操作,一步到位